Discovering Pure Classical Pilates: Theory and Practice as Joseph Pilates Intended

Rate this book
Discovering Pure Classical Pilates looks deeply into Joseph Pilates' traditional method of mental and physical conditioning by describing its foundations, goals, movement qualities and benefits. Specific attention is given to the ways in which market forces, individual creativity or ambition lead to deterioration and commercialization of the traditional Pilates method. We harken back in time to Joseph Pilates' own two books Your Health (1934) and Return to Life Through Contrology (1945) by exploring social, economic, psychological and spiritual issues associated with his traditional work.

Author made a great series of classical pilates videos with leading 2nd generation teachers like Bob Liekens and Alycea Ungaro. This book is an extensive treatise on preserving the quality and integrity of pure, classical pilates, as taught by Joseph Pilates to Romana Kryzanowska and Jay Grimes. Romana has trained the largest number of 2nd generation classical pilates teachers, including the author.

This book does not contain any actual exercises. It is mostly a critique of corporate, commercial pilates with instructors and apparatus of questionable quality and safety.
